Transaction 66ed072edc9f050d63ae103b2f386962fe2c5ba5faf2b3f65b127bd313d0b041
1 Input
2 Outputs
- 66ed072edc9f050d63ae103b2f386962fe2c5ba5faf2b3f65b127bd313d0b041:0
- 66ed072edc9f050d63ae103b2f386962fe2c5ba5faf2b3f65b127bd313d0b041:1
value 770737
address 1DiDJn3bQ1kALbuCrNH3RAJBBNgEJy2ztR
value 1165263
address 17L8musuUwnELjm4SUUscXZiEpNA7syxnP